40-year-old tried to strangle woman in park. Police found body in his apartment

Summary by Gazeta
In Marek Grechuta Park in Krakow, a man was strangling a woman. Witnesses overpowered the 40-year-old and handed him over to the police. Officers found the body of a 79-year-old woman in his apartment.

Police officers found the body of a 79-year-old woman in a house in the Skala commune near Krakow. The discovery was made after the arrest of a man who had attacked a woman in a Krakow park the day before. As investigators determined, the deceased was the mother of the detainee.
